Handover note — Crumbwheel order cutoffs.

Welcome aboard. The bakery cutoff rule in Crumbwheel closes same-day orders at 14:00 local to each storefront, not UTC — this has bitten us twice. Holiday overrides live in the calendar service and take precedence silently, so always check there first when a cutoff looks wrong. To unlock the calendar service's admin console after a restart, enter the recovery passphrase below.

vault phrase of bagap-bahaf = silion-pelox-sorox-casdor-quenwyn-fraax-eliox-praael-kelion-quenvan-kasox-rusael-norius-belvan

Subject: Handover — Profilestore sharding, week of the cutover

Hi Daro,

Taking over from me tonight: the user-profile store is mid-migration from the single Kestrel node to four hash-sharded replicas. Shards 1–3 are live; shard 4 backfill finishes around 03:00. If the backfill stalls, restart the copier job — it is idempotent. Do not run schema changes until all four shards report synced. Monitoring is on the usual dashboard. The coordinator node is reachable at the connection string below.

warehouse DSN: mssql://rusdor_svc:0FSWCn9@db-951a.paliqforge.local:5432/ulawyn

Subject: DR drill Thursday — Harkfield reporting DB. Support team: during the drill we'll restore last quarter's monthly partitions to the standby cluster. Expect read-only mode on historical queries for roughly two hours. Current-month partition stays live; only archive lookups are affected. Log any customer complaints in the Bramble tracker with the drill tag. Do not escalate partition-lag alerts — they're expected. Standby console access for the drill uses the recovery passphrase below.

vault phrase of fahog-yajog = frawyn-jordor-casael-gormir-olieth-julmir

If Squatcheck flags a legitimate internal package as typo-squatting, first verify the allowlist entry matches the exact registry scope, including casing. Mismatched scopes are the most common false positive. Re-run the scan locally before approving the review. To fetch the latest allowlist snapshot from the Fernholt registry API, authenticate with the bearer token below.

session JWT of yawep-yawep = eyJhbGciOiJIUzI1NiIsInR5cCI6IkpXVCJ9.eyJzdWIiOiI3pWF3_In0.aXYsHiog